Ozzy Gives Up On Sabbath Reunion Tour

Ozzy Osbourne

Ozzy Osbourne has given up making plans for a Black Sabbath 40th anniversary tour - because his bandmates cannot make their minds up.

The rocker first heard there was a big tour planned and the next thing he knew, it had been called off.

And now Osbourne is tired of all the confusion.

He tells the Sydney Morning Herald newspaper, "If it happens, it happens, if it don’t, it don’t… You get a phone call: ‘It’s off!’ Then it’s back on again."

"You know what? I don’t want to say yes, and I don’t want to say no, because I’ve put my foot in my mouth so many times. If it’s meant to happen, it will happen."

Osbourne’s former Sabbath bandmates are currently touring with Ronnie James Dio as Heaven & Hell.
